India, being an agrarian country, generates millions of tons of crop residue (stubble) every year. Traditionally, farmers have resorted to burning this stubble in the fields, leading to severe air pollution, soil degradation, and health problems. Today, as sustainable development becomes more crucial than ever, utilizing stubble for energy production instead of burning it offers a promising new opportunity. In this context, biogas has emerged as an effective solution.
The Problem: Harmful Effects of Stubble Burning
- Air Pollution: Stubble burning releases hazardous pollutants like carbon monoxide, nitrogen oxides, and fine particulate matter (PM2.5) into the atmosphere.
- Soil Degradation: The intense heat from burning kills essential soil microbes, leading to a decline in soil fertility.
- Health Issues: Smoke exposure increases respiratory diseases such as asthma, bronchitis, and other complications, especially in urban areas.
- Climate Change: The emission of greenhouse gases accelerates global warming.
Did You Know?
India generates approximately 500 million tons of crop residue annually, of which about 140 million tons are burned. Converting just half of this to biogas could power over 5 million rural households.
The Solution: Biogas Production from Crop Residue
Through biogas plants, stubble and other agricultural waste can undergo anaerobic digestion and be transformed into clean energy. The biogas generated can be used for cooking, heating, and electricity production. Moreover, the by-product of this process, called digestate, serves as a high-quality organic fertilizer, reducing the dependency on chemical fertilizers.
Energy Production
1 ton of crop residue can produce approximately 300-400 m³ of biogas, equivalent to 150-200 liters of diesel.
Fertilizer Byproduct
The digestate from biogas production contains valuable nutrients that can replace up to 25% of chemical fertilizers.

Key Benefits of Biogas
- Clean Energy Source: Biogas provides a sustainable alternative for cooking, heating, and power generation.
- Additional Income: Farmers can either sell their crop residue or establish their own biogas units for added revenue.
- Improved Soil Health: The organic fertilizer produced from biogas plants enhances soil fertility.
- Environmental Benefits: Reduces greenhouse gas emissions and helps prevent deforestation.
- Energy Security: Rural communities become less dependent on external energy sources.
Process of Biogas Generation from Crop Residue
- Collection of crop residue and shredding it into smaller pieces.
- Feeding the shredded residue into a biogas digester where anaerobic bacteria break down the material.
- Production of biogas (mainly methane and carbon dioxide) through fermentation.
- Utilization of biogas for household energy needs like cooking and lighting, and in some cases, for electricity generation.
- Use of the leftover digestate as a nutrient-rich organic fertilizer for farming.

Government Support for Biogas Initiatives
- National Biogas and Organic Manure Programme (NBOMP): Promotes biogas production at the rural level through subsidies and technical assistance.
- State-level incentives: Several state governments offer additional financial support for the setup of biogas plants.
- Research and Development Grants: Encouraging innovations in waste-to-energy technologies.
